Latest Patents
Mark Navarra's latest patents include innovative designs aimed at improving telecommunications components. One of his patents describes a telecommunications system that comprises a first printed circuit board associated with a first port, featuring first plated through holes for receiving insulation displacement contacts. This design aims to reduce alien crosstalk between ports, enhancing the overall performance of telecommunications systems. Another patent focuses on a patch panel that includes a conductive shield positioned between connecting blocks to further minimize alien crosstalk.
